WhatsApp: +86 18037808511In the planetary ball mill, kinetic energy is transferred at collision event [28]. Rotation speed determined the total energy input from the mill, while the charge ratio, or the quantity and mass of the mill balls, determined the collision frequency and subsequent energy distribution [20]. Planetary ball mills provide high energy density due to the superimposed effect of two centrifugal fields produced by the rotation of the supporting disc and the rotation of the vials around its own axis in the opposite direction .During operation, the grinding balls execute motion paths that result in frictional and impact effects.

WhatsApp: +86 18037808511In comparison, internally agitated high energy ball mills, such as a batch process Attritor, scale up easily and efficiently to large production machines capable of processing hundreds of gallons per batch. Attritors also can run in continuous mode, which is another advantage over planetary mills, which cannot run in continuous mode.
